⏱ 18 min
Il mercato globale del quantum computing è previsto raggiungere oltre 64 miliardi di dollari entro il 2030, indicando una crescita esponenziale e un interesse crescente per questa tecnologia trasformativa.
Il Quarto Stato della Materia: Oltre i Bit Classici
Per comprendere la rivoluzione che il quantum computing promette, dobbiamo prima fare un passo indietro e rivalutare i principi fondamentali su cui si basa l'informatica attuale. I computer che utilizziamo quotidianamente, dagli smartphone ai supercomputer, operano sulla base di transistor che immagazzinano informazioni sotto forma di bit. Un bit può rappresentare uno stato logico binario: 0 o 1. Questa dicotomia è stata la spina dorsale dell'era digitale, permettendo progressi inimmaginabili in quasi ogni aspetto della nostra vita. Tuttavia, questa architettura classica, pur essendo incredibilmente potente, presenta dei limiti intrinseci quando si tratta di affrontare problemi di complessità esponenziale. Pensiamo a problemi come la simulazione di molecole complesse per la scoperta di nuovi farmaci, l'ottimizzazione di catene logistiche globali con milioni di variabili, o la rottura degli attuali standard di crittografia. Per un computer classico, la complessità di questi problemi cresce in modo così drastico con l'aumentare dei parametri che diventa rapidamente impraticabile, anche per le macchine più potenti, trovare una soluzione in tempi ragionevoli. È qui che entra in gioco il quantum computing, promettendo di superare questi limiti attraverso l'utilizzo di principi della meccanica quantistica. La meccanica quantistica descrive il comportamento della materia e dell'energia a livello atomico e subatomico, un regno dove le leggi della fisica classica sembrano cedere il passo a fenomeni controintuitivi e affascinanti. Il quantum computing non è semplicemente un'evoluzione dei computer classici, ma un paradigma computazionale radicalmente nuovo, capace di sfruttare le stranezze del mondo quantistico per eseguire calcoli in modi precedentemente inaccessibili.I Fondamenti della Computazione Quantistica: Qubit e Sovrapposizione
Il cuore della computazione quantistica risiede nel suo elemento fondamentale: il qubit, o bit quantistico. A differenza del bit classico, che può essere solo 0 o 1, un qubit può esistere in una combinazione lineare di entrambi gli stati contemporaneamente. Questo fenomeno è noto come "sovrapposizione quantistica". Immaginate una moneta che, invece di essere testa o croce, può essere testa, croce o in uno stato di indeterminatezza dove entrambe le possibilità coesistono fino a quando non viene osservata. Matematicamente, uno stato di qubit può essere rappresentato come $|\psi\rangle = \alpha|0\rangle + \beta|1\rangle$, dove $|0\rangle$ e $|1\rangle$ sono gli stati base (corrispondenti a 0 e 1 classici), e $\alpha$ e $\beta$ sono numeri complessi chiamati ampiezze di probabilità. La somma dei quadrati dei moduli di queste ampiezze deve essere uguale a 1 ($\vert\alpha\vert^2 + \vert\beta\vert^2 = 1$), poiché la probabilità totale di trovare il qubit in uno stato o nell'altro deve essere 1. Quando misuriamo un qubit, la sovrapposizione "collassa" in uno dei suoi stati base, con una probabilità determinata dalle sue ampiezze. Questa capacità di rappresentare e manipolare più stati contemporaneamente è ciò che conferisce ai computer quantistici il loro potenziale potere. Mentre N bit classici possono rappresentare solo uno dei $2^N$ possibili stati in un dato momento, N qubit in sovrapposizione possono rappresentare tutti i $2^N$ stati simultaneamente. Ciò significa che un computer quantistico con un numero relativamente piccolo di qubit può esplorare un numero enormemente maggiore di possibilità rispetto a un computer classico con un numero equivalente di bit. Ad esempio, 300 qubit possono rappresentare più stati di quanti atomi esistano nell'universo osservabile. Questa capacità di parallelismo intrinseco è la chiave per risolvere alcuni dei problemi computazionali più difficili.1
Bit Classico
0 o 1
Stati Possibili
N
Bit Classici
2N
Stati Rappresentabili
1
Qubit
α|0⟩ + β|1⟩
Stati Possibili (Sovrapposizione)
N
Qubit
2N
Stati Rappresentabili Simultaneamente
Entanglement: La Connessione Quantistica che Sfida la Logica
Oltre alla sovrapposizione, un altro fenomeno quantistico fondamentale per il quantum computing è l'entanglement. L'entanglement descrive una connessione speciale tra due o più qubit, dove i loro destini diventano intrinsecamente legati, indipendentemente dalla distanza che li separa. Quando i qubit sono entangled, misurare lo stato di uno di essi influenza istantaneamente lo stato degli altri, come se fossero collegati da un filo invisibile. Albert Einstein descrisse questo fenomeno come "spettrale azione a distanza" perché sembrava violare il principio di località, secondo cui un oggetto può essere influenzato solo dal suo ambiente immediato. Tuttavia, numerosi esperimenti hanno confermato l'esistenza dell'entanglement, rendendolo una risorsa potente per il calcolo quantistico. L'entanglement consente di eseguire operazioni che non sarebbero possibili con qubit indipendenti. Permette la creazione di correlazioni complesse tra i qubit, che sono essenziali per l'esecuzione di algoritmi quantistici avanzati. Ad esempio, molti algoritmi quantistici utilizzano porte logiche quantistiche che creano o manipolano l'entanglement tra i qubit per eseguire calcoli complessi. La generazione e il mantenimento dell'entanglement sono sfide significative. I qubit entangled sono estremamente sensibili alle perturbazioni ambientali, che possono causare la perdita di entanglement (decoerenza). La capacità di creare e controllare entanglement su larga scala è un obiettivo primario per la costruzione di computer quantistici capaci e affidabili.Complessità di un Problema per Numero di Qubit (Teorico)
Algoritmi Quantistici Rivoluzionari: Dal Drug Discovery alla Crittografia
La vera potenza della computazione quantistica si manifesta quando viene applicata a specifici algoritmi quantistici, progettati per sfruttare la sovrapposizione e l'entanglement. Alcuni degli algoritmi più noti includono: * **Algoritmo di Shor:** Questo algoritmo rivoluzionario, proposto da Peter Shor nel 1994, può fattorizzare numeri interi enormi in tempi esponenzialmente più brevi rispetto agli algoritmi classici più efficienti. Ciò ha implicazioni profonde per la crittografia moderna, in quanto molti sistemi di sicurezza, come RSA, si basano sulla difficoltà di fattorizzare grandi numeri. Un computer quantistico in grado di eseguire l'algoritmo di Shor su larga scala potrebbe rompere gran parte della crittografia attualmente in uso, rendendo necessaria la transizione verso la crittografia post-quantistica. Wikipedia: Shor's algorithm * **Algoritmo di Grover:** Sviluppato da Lov Grover nel 1996, questo algoritmo offre un vantaggio quadratico nell'ambito della ricerca in database non ordinati. Mentre un algoritmo classico richiederebbe in media N/2 tentativi per trovare un elemento in un database di N elementi, l'algoritmo di Grover può farlo in circa $\sqrt{N}$ tentativi. Sebbene non sia un vantaggio esponenziale come quello di Shor, è comunque significativo per ottimizzare operazioni di ricerca complesse. * **Simulazione Quantistica:** Uno dei campi più promettenti per la computazione quantistica è la simulazione di sistemi quantistici stessi. Questo è particolarmente rilevante per la chimica computazionale e la scoperta di farmaci. Simulando accuratamente il comportamento di molecole complesse, i ricercatori potrebbero accelerare notevolmente il processo di identificazione e progettazione di nuovi farmaci, materiali e catalizzatori. Attualmente, la simulazione di molecole anche relativamente piccole è estremamente costosa computazionalmente per i computer classici. * **Ottimizzazione:** L'algoritmo di ottimizzazione quantistica approssimata (QAOA) e l'algoritmo di ricottura quantistica (Quantum Annealing) sono progettati per risolvere problemi di ottimizzazione complessi, come la pianificazione di rotte, la gestione del portafoglio finanziario e l'ottimizzazione delle reti. Questi algoritmi, una volta pienamente implementati su computer quantistici su larga scala, potrebbero sbloccare soluzioni per problemi che oggi consideriamo intrattabili.| Campo di Applicazione | Algoritmo Quantistico Chiave | Vantaggio Rispetto ai Metodi Classici | Implicazioni Principali |
|---|---|---|---|
| Crittografia | Algoritmo di Shor | Esponenziale | Rottura degli attuali sistemi crittografici (es. RSA), necessità di crittografia post-quantistica. |
| Ricerca e Database | Algoritmo di Grover | Quadratico | Accelerazione della ricerca in grandi insiemi di dati non ordinati. |
| Scienza dei Materiali e Farmaceutica | Simulazione Quantistica | Esponenziale (per sistemi complessi) | Progettazione e scoperta di nuovi farmaci, materiali avanzati, catalizzatori. |
| Ottimizzazione (Logistica, Finanza, IA) | QAOA, Quantum Annealing | Significativo (dipende dal problema) | Soluzione di problemi di ottimizzazione complessi in tempi ridotti. |
Il Tuo Smartphone del Futuro: Una Realtà Lontana o Imminente?
La domanda che molti si pongono è: quando vedremo i computer quantistici entrare nelle nostre vite quotidiane, magari in forma di uno smartphone quantistico? La risposta breve è: non nel prossimo futuro, almeno non nella forma in cui immaginiamo uno smartphone "quantistico" come lo intendiamo oggi. I computer quantistici attuali, noti come NISQ (Noisy Intermediate-Scale Quantum), sono caratterizzati da un numero limitato di qubit (decine o poche centinaia) e sono suscettibili al rumore e alla decoerenza. Sono macchine ancora molto costose, ingombranti e richiedono condizioni operative estreme (come temperature criogeniche). È altamente improbabile che questi dispositivi diventino compatti e accessibili come uno smartphone nel breve o medio termine. Tuttavia, questo non significa che la tecnologia quantistica non influenzerà i nostri dispositivi. Ci sono diverse prospettive: * **Accesso tramite Cloud:** La tendenza più probabile nel prossimo futuro è l'accesso ai computer quantistici tramite servizi cloud. Le aziende e i ricercatori potranno utilizzare potenti risorse quantistiche da remoto, delegando i calcoli complessi a data center quantistici. In questo scenario, il tuo smartphone o laptop diventerebbe un "terminale" per accedere a questi potenti cervelli quantistici. * **Acceleratori Quantistici Ibridi:** Potremmo vedere l'integrazione di piccoli acceleratori quantistici (forse basati su principi quantistici specifici, ma non necessariamente computatori quantistici universali) all'interno di dispositivi più potenti, per eseguire compiti specifici che beneficiano di approcci quantistici. Questo potrebbe essere simile a come le GPU (Graphics Processing Unit) sono diventate componenti standard per accelerare i calcoli grafici. * **Nuove Funzionalità di Sicurezza:** La crittografia post-quantistica, una volta standardizzata, sarà essenziale per proteggere i dati. I nostri dispositivi dovranno essere aggiornati per resistere agli attacchi dei futuri computer quantistici. Questo implica lo sviluppo di nuovi algoritmi e protocolli di crittografia resistenti al quantum. * **Sensori Quantistici:** Tecnologie basate su principi quantistici, come sensori estremamente precisi per la navigazione, la diagnostica medica o il monitoraggio ambientale, potrebbero trovare posto nei dispositivi consumer prima ancora che la computazione quantistica universale diventi pervasiva. In sintesi, uno "smartphone quantistico" nel senso di un dispositivo che esegue calcoli quantistici complessi direttamente sul dispositivo, è una visione futuristica. Più realisticamente, l'impatto della computazione quantistica si farà sentire attraverso l'accesso a servizi cloud, nuove forme di sicurezza e potenziali acceleratori specializzati.Sfide Tecnologiche e i Costi Elevati
La strada verso computer quantistici su larga scala e tolleranti ai fault (FTQC - Fault-Tolerant Quantum Computers) è disseminata di ostacoli tecnologici significativi. Il più pressante è la **decoerenza quantistica**. I qubit sono estremamente fragili e interagiscono con il loro ambiente, perdendo rapidamente le loro proprietà quantistiche (sovrapposizione ed entanglement). Per mantenere le informazioni quantistiche per un tempo sufficiente a eseguire calcoli utili, è necessario isolare i qubit in modo quasi perfetto e operare in condizioni estreme, come temperature criogeniche vicine allo zero assoluto. Un'altra sfida critica è la **scalabilità**. Costruire sistemi con un numero elevato di qubit interconnessi e controllabili è estremamente complesso. Ogni qubit aggiunto aumenta la complessità del sistema di controllo e la probabilità di errore. Attualmente, i computer quantistici più avanzati dispongono di poche centinaia di qubit, ma per risolvere problemi di grande interesse pratico, come la fattorizzazione di numeri molto grandi o la simulazione di molecole complesse, potrebbero essere necessari milioni di qubit logici. La **correzione degli errori quantistici** è fondamentale per superare la fragilità dei qubit. A differenza dei computer classici, dove gli errori possono essere facilmente rilevati e corretti duplicando le informazioni, la correzione degli errori quantistici è molto più complessa. Ciò richiede l'utilizzo di più qubit fisici per rappresentare un singolo qubit logico tollerante ai fault, aumentando ulteriormente i requisiti di scalabilità. Un qubit logico stabile potrebbe richiedere centinaia o migliaia di qubit fisici. Infine, i **costi** associati alla ricerca, allo sviluppo e alla costruzione di questi sistemi sono astronomici. Le infrastrutture necessarie, come i sistemi criogenici, le camere a vuoto e i complessi sistemi di controllo laser o microonde, richiedono investimenti enormi. Questo limita l'accesso alla tecnologia ai grandi enti di ricerca e alle aziende con notevoli risorse finanziarie.Decoerenza
Perdita di stati quantistici dovuta all'ambiente.
Scalabilità
Difficoltà nell'aumentare il numero di qubit interconnessi.
Correzione Errori
Necessità di più qubit fisici per un qubit logico stabile.
Costi Elevati
Enormi investimenti in ricerca, infrastrutture e manutenzione.
"La sfida più grande non è solo costruire più qubit, ma renderli più stabili e interconnessi in modo affidabile. La strada verso i computer quantistici tolleranti ai fault è lunga e richiederà innovazioni fondamentali in fisica e ingegneria."
— Dr. Elena Rossi, Ricercatrice in Fisica Quantistica
Il Mercato Quantistico: Opportunità e Investimenti
Nonostante le sfide, il potenziale trasformativo della computazione quantistica sta guidando un'ondata senza precedenti di investimenti e innovazione. Il mercato quantistico è in rapida espansione, attraendo non solo giganti tecnologici come IBM, Google, Microsoft e Amazon, ma anche un ecosistema fiorente di startup specializzate. Gli investimenti stanno confluendo in diverse aree: * **Hardware Quantistico:** Sviluppo di diverse architetture di qubit (superconduttori, ioni intrappolati, ecc.) e miglioramento della loro stabilità e scalabilità. * **Software e Algoritmi Quantistici:** Creazione di linguaggi di programmazione quantistica, compilatori, simulatori e lo sviluppo di nuovi algoritmi per risolvere problemi specifici. * **Servizi Cloud Quantistici:** Offerta di accesso a risorse computazionali quantistiche tramite piattaforme cloud, democratizzando l'accesso a questa tecnologia. * **Applicazioni Verticali:** Identificazione e sviluppo di casi d'uso concreti in settori come la finanza, la farmaceutica, la scienza dei materiali, la logistica e la sicurezza informatica. Secondo una recente analisi di Reuters, il finanziamento globale per le startup quantistiche ha raggiunto cifre record negli ultimi anni, con un crescente interesse da parte di fondi di venture capital. Questo indica una forte fiducia nelle potenzialità a lungo termine del settore. La competizione è accesa, ma la collaborazione è altrettanto importante. Le partnership tra università, centri di ricerca e aziende private stanno accelerando il progresso. L'obiettivo comune è quello di superare le sfide tecniche e portare i computer quantistici da promettenti strumenti di laboratorio a potenti motori di innovazione globale. Il percorso verso uno smartphone quantistico potrebbe essere ancora lontano, ma l'influenza della tecnologia quantistica sulle nostre vite è già in atto e si intensificherà nei prossimi anni, rivoluzionando la scienza, l'industria e, infine, la nostra interazione con la tecnologia.I computer quantistici sostituiranno i computer classici?
Non nel prossimo futuro. I computer quantistici eccellono in specifici tipi di problemi (es. fattorizzazione, simulazione quantistica) che sono intrattabili per i computer classici. Tuttavia, per la maggior parte delle attività quotidiane come la navigazione web, l'elaborazione di testi o i giochi, i computer classici rimarranno più efficienti ed economici. Si prevede una coesistenza, con i computer quantistici che agiscono come acceleratori specializzati accessibili tramite cloud.
Quando potrò avere uno smartphone quantistico?
Uno "smartphone quantistico" come dispositivo per eseguire calcoli quantistici direttamente su di esso è una prospettiva molto lontana, probabilmente decenni. Le attuali macchine quantistiche sono ingombranti, costose e richiedono condizioni operative estreme. L'impatto quantistico sui dispositivi consumer si manifesterà inizialmente tramite accesso cloud, nuove funzionalità di sicurezza e sensori quantistici.
Qual è il rischio principale per la sicurezza informatica legato ai computer quantistici?
Il rischio principale è la capacità di un computer quantistico sufficientemente potente di rompere gli attuali algoritmi crittografici asimmetrici, come RSA, che sono alla base di gran parte della sicurezza online (transazioni bancarie, comunicazioni sicure, ecc.). Questo è dovuto all'efficacia dell'algoritmo di Shor nel fattorizzare numeri primi enormi. Per questo motivo, la ricerca sulla crittografia post-quantistica è diventata una priorità.
Quanti qubit sono necessari per avere un computer quantistico veramente utile?
Il numero di qubit necessari dipende dal problema specifico. Per dimostrare vantaggi quantistici significativi e risolvere problemi di interesse pratico, si parla di centinaia o migliaia di qubit logici tolleranti ai fault. I computer quantistici attuali (NISQ) hanno decine o poche centinaia di qubit fisici, che sono rumorosi e non tolleranti ai fault. La transizione da qubit fisici a qubit logici stabili è una delle maggiori sfide.
